The drift scanner flagged that the per-client token-bucket settings in the us-inland cluster no longer match the declared baseline; burst capacity appears to have been raised manually during last week's incident and never reverted. Partner-facing limits are unaffected, but internal batch jobs are currently able to exceed intended throughput, which risks saturating the ledger service downstream. Please reconcile against source control before the next deploy. The expected baseline values are as follows.

deployment values, bahip-bawip:
ulawyn:
  log_level: warn
  metrics_host: metrics.ulawyn.lumicsys.internal
  pool_size: 16

# Break-Glass: Catalog Cache Invalidation

Scope: the Pinrow product catalog at Veldstone Retail. If stale prices persist after a purge and the Hollowmere invalidation queue is wedged, use break-glass to flush the edge tier directly. Contractors: get verbal sign-off from the catalog lead first. Steps: open the Hollowmere admin shell, select emergency-flush, confirm the tenant, and run it once — repeated flushes thrash the origin. Access is logged and expires after 20 minutes. Unseal the admin shell with the passphrase below.

recovery phrase for kahop-tajog: istix-casvan

Runbook: StormPing fan-out. Alerts from the Gale feed hit the dispatcher on node cluster `sp-fanout`. If fan-out stalls, restart the `gustd` worker and verify queue depth is under 500. Contractors: never edit routing rules directly; file a change with the Vexley ops lead. Before restarting, confirm the dispatcher env file is complete. The signing credential for the Gale feed goes on the next line.

env line for tawig-kadup: VAULT_KEY5=07c4f

Handover for the Vellumgate proctoring queue, from Odran to whoever inherits this. The queue assigns incoming exam sessions to available proctors with a fairness weight; starvation alerts fire if any session waits over four minutes. Watch the retry path — requeued sessions must keep their original timestamp. The dispatcher reads its runtime configuration at startup, listed below.

settings of tagef-bawif:
DRUIX_HOST=druix.zemvarlabs.internal
DRUIX_PORT=8000